Frequently asked questions
What factors affect heat pump efficiency calculations?
Climate zone, home insulation, current heating system type, local energy rates, and heat pump SEER/HSPF ratings all impact efficiency calculations and potential savings.
How accurate are the payback period estimates?
Estimates are based on current energy prices and usage patterns. Actual payback may vary due to energy price fluctuations and changing usage habits.
Do heat pumps work efficiently in cold climates?
Modern heat pumps with cold climate ratings work efficiently down to -15°F, though efficiency decreases as temperatures drop below freezing.
